At Southport State High School, our dedicated team of over 200 full- and part-time staff, volunteers, contractors, and community support representatives works together to provide quality education and care in a clean, safe, and supportive environment for every student.
We proudly employ more than 110 teachers who deliver engaging lessons across a wide range of subjects from years 7 to 12, ensuring every student has the opportunity to excel.
In addition to our teaching staff, our comprehensive support services include career guidance, indigenous support, chaplaincy, school nursing, IT support, scientific assistance, teacher aides, as well as janitorial, grounds, and office personnel—all committed to creating a vibrant, welcoming campus.
Our deans are dedicated to both junior and senior students, working closely with families to address support needs and promote student well-being.
At Southport State High School, every member of our community is here to help your student thrive and succeed.
